Smoked Salmon With Yogurt And Capers
Total Time: 10 mins
Preparation Time: 10 mins
Ingredients
- 2 slices country bread, toasted 
- 1/2 cup low-fat greek yogurt (plain) or 1/2 cup low-fat plain yogurt (strained, see note) 
- 3 ounces smoked salmon (sliced) 
- 1/4 small red onion, sliced thin 
- 1 tablespoon capers, drained 
-  fresh ground black pepper 
Recipe
- 1 cut each toast in half and divide yogurt equally among the four portions; smooth to edges with the back of your spoon. 
- 2 top each with an equal amount of the smoked salmon. 
- 3 sprinkle with red onions and capers; season with black pepper. 
- 4 note: if using regular plain yogurt, you can easily make it the consistency of greek yogurt by what i call straining. i use a small clean strainer and spoon some yogurt into it and let it drip over a bowl for 15 to 20 minutes until it reaches the desired consistency.
